“In the Mudd” Speaker Series: Caryn Dugan-The Center for Plant-Based Living


Event Details

  • Date: April 7, 2023 12:30 pm – 2:00 pm
  • Venue: Mudd's Grove

 

Meet Caryn Dugan, founder and owner of The Center for Plant-Based Living, the plant-based nutrition and culinary education center located in Kirkwood.

Hear about her journey, and how you too can begin or tweak a healthier diet.

What is the question Caryn is most asked? “How do I begin?”. Her answer, A Plant On Every Plate! Where do plants come from – the MUDD .
